Abstract
Data integrity is crucial in the provision of a data service. For the CT2 digital cordless system, the 32 kbps duplex channel is exploited to support synchronous and asynchronous data services. The CT2 standard proposed in Europe uses the Reed Solomon (RS) forward error correction (FEC) as the forward error correction technique to achieve data integrity. We investigate the feasibility of the provision wireless asynchronous or synchronous services for in-building data applications and present results of the performance of the (63,k) RS code over the indoor radio channel for the CT2 system
